Performance Tips & Optimization
- Lower water quality and volumetric lighting for major FPS gains
- Enable DLSS, FSR, or XeSS (if supported) at 1440p and 4K
- Install Subnautica 2 on an NVMe SSD to reduce streaming delays
- 16GB RAM minimum; 32GB recommended for large bases
- Keep GPU drivers updated for optimal stability
